Engine Identification
Engine Data Plate
The engine data plate provides important facts about the engine. The engine serial number (ESN) and control parts list (CPL) provide information for service and ordering parts. The engine data plate must not be changed unless approved by Cummins Inc.
The data plate is located on the top side of the gear housing. Have the following engine data available when communicating with a Cummins Authorized Repair Location:

NOTE: If the engine data plate (1) is not readable, the ESN (2) can be found on the engine block on top of the lubricating oil cooler housing. Additional engine information is on the electronic control module (ECM) data plate.

Fuel Injection Pump Data Plate
The Cummins Accumulator Pump System (CAPS) fuel injection pump data plate is located on the side of the injection pump. The data plate contains the following information:
Reference Number Description
A Cummins part number
B Pump serial number
C Factory code

The ECM data plate is located on the front of the ECM. The following information is found on the ECM data plate: • ECM part number (PN) • ECM serial number (SN) • ECM date code (DC) • Engine serial number (ESN) • ECM Code (identifies the software in the ECM).

ITEMS QSL9
Engine Type Water-cooled, 4 cycle, In-line, Turbo charged and inter-cooled Combustion Chamber Type Direct Injection Type Cylinder Liner Type Replaceable Wet Liner Timing Gear System Gear Driven Type Piston Type Articulated Piston (Steel top/ Al skirt) No. of cylinder-BorexStroke (mm) 6 - 114x145 Total Piston Displacement (cc) 8,900 Engine Dimension (w/o CAC pipe) (lengthxwidthxheight) (mm) 1,128x785x1,080 Rotating Direction (from Flywheel) Counter Clockwise Engine Weight (kg) 738 Firing Order 1 - 5 - 3 - 6 - 2 - 4 Fuel High-pressure Pump Type Cummins high press electronic fuel pump Engine Control Type Electric control type (CM850 ECM)
Valve Clearance Intake valve 0.012 in (0.305mm) Exhaust valve 0.022 in (0.559mm)
Fuel Filter Type (Filtration)
Main fuel filter Full-flow cartridge (3 micron) Pre-fuel filter Full-flow cartridge (30 micron) Min. at idle speed 0.69 Oil Pressure (kg/cm2) Max. at rated speed 3.1 Min. oil pressure for E/G protection 0.69 Using Lubrication Oil ACEA-E5 (API CH-4 or CI-4 class) oil grade Lubrication Method Full forced pressure feed type Oil Pump Type Gear type driven by crankshaft Oil Filter Type Cartridge type Lubricating Oil Capacity Max. 25 Oil Cooler Type Belt driven centrifugal type Cooling Method Pressurized circulation Cooling Water Capacity (engine only) (lit) 11 Open at (°C) 82°C Thermostat Open wide at (°C) 93°C Max. coolant temp. for E/G protection (°C) 113°C Turbo Charger Exhaust gas driven type (waste gate) Engine Stop System Fuel feeding shut-off by ECU Alternator (voltage-capacity) (V - A) 24 - 70 Starting Motor (voltage-output) (V - kW) 24 - 7.5 Air Heater Capacity (V - AH) 24 - 100 Battery Capacity 24 - 150

ITEMS QSL9
Rated Power (ps/rpm) 284 / 2,000 Max. Power (ps/rpm) 314 / 1,700 Performance Data Max. Torque (kg•m/rpm) 148 / 1,400 High idle (rpm) 2,060 ± 50 Low idle (rpm) 800 ± 25 * All data are based on operation without cooling fan at SAE J1995 gross.
